What does Ciaran mean?

Ciaran is a boy name of Irish (Gaelic) origin meaning “little dark one”. From Gaelic ciar meaning black, borne by early Irish saints.

How common is Ciaran?

Recorded births named Ciaran by country
CountryBirths on record
United States since 18802,233 births
England & Wales since 19965,248 births
Scotland since 19742,033 births
Northern Ireland since 19971,444 births
Ireland since 196412,102 births

Counts come from official national birth-registration statistics: U.S. Social Security Administration, England & Wales (Office for National Statistics), Scotland (National Records of Scotland), Northern Ireland (NISRA), Ireland (Central Statistics Office) and New Zealand (Dept. of Internal Affairs). Coverage spans differ, so totals aren't directly comparable across countries.

Ciaran's popularity over time

514 19962025

Babies named Ciaran per year, England & Wales (1996 to 2025). England & Wales peaked in 2004 (514/yr) · Ireland peaked in 1982 (359/yr) · Northern Ireland peaked in 1998 (119/yr) · Scotland peaked in 2004 (118/yr) · United States peaked in 2025 (110/yr).

How popular is Ciaran?

Ciaran is an uncommon baby name in the United States. It was most common in 2025, when it ranked #3,328 nationally (given to 168 babies that year).
